一、如何以管理员权限打开cmd
管理员权限是一种比普通权限更高的操作权限,在操作系统中,它可以让用户执行一些需要更改系统设置或者更改系统文件的操作,这些操作需要普通用户所没有的权限。
在Windows系统上,我们通常需要以管理员权限打开cmd来执行一些高级操作。下面是以不同的方式打开cmd的具体步骤:
1. 通过快捷方式以管理员身份打开cmd(推荐)
找到桌面上的cmd快捷方式,右键单击并选择“以管理员身份运行”
2. 通过Win + X菜单以管理员身份打开cmd
按下Win + X组合键,选择“Windows PowerShell(管理员)”或“命令提示符(管理员)”
3. 通过搜索栏以管理员身份打开cmd
在Windows搜索栏中键入cmd,右键单击并选择“以管理员身份运行”
二、管理员权限下的cmd常用操作
在以管理员权限运行cmd之后,我们可以进行许多常规用户不能操作的高级操作。下面介绍一些常用的cmd操作。
1. 查看网络连接信息
netstat -a
该命令可以查看所有的TCP和UDP端口连接,以及当前系统中所有的网络连接信息。
2. 获取系统信息
systeminfo
该命令可以获取当前系统的详细信息,包括操作系统版本、内存、硬件配置等。
3. 列出指定目录下的文件列表
dir [目录路径]
该命令可以列出指定目录下的所有文件和文件夹信息。
4. 查看系统进程
tasklist
该命令可以查看当前所有正在运行的进程。
5. 管理本地用户和组
net user [用户名] [密码] /add
net localgroup [组名] [用户名] /add
这两条命令可以分别创建一个新用户和一个新组,并将用户添加到组中。
三、使用Python代码以管理员权限打开cmd
在Python中,我们可以使用subprocess模块来执行系统命令,并以管理员权限打开cmd。
import subprocess
subprocess.call(["runas", "/user:管理员用户名", "cmd"])
上述代码中,我们通过subprocess.call()函数来调用runas命令,用于以管理员权限执行cmd命令并打开命令提示符窗口。
四、结语
以管理员权限打开cmd是执行高级操作的必要条件,在Windows系统中,我们可以使用多种方式来以管理员权限打开cmd,例如使用快捷方式、Win + X菜单或者搜索栏。同时,我们还可以在cmd中使用许多高级的系统命令,例如获取系统信息、查看网络连接和管理用户组等。
如果我们需要在Python代码中以管理员权限打开cmd,可以使用subprocess模块中的runas命令来实现。